Chevy dealer installs LG LT headers and Vararm CAI. Service Manager tells me the CEL will come on the forth or fifith time I start the car. And they will not do a tune to make it go away. Sure enough it comes on the fifth time I drive the car.
So I make a appiontment at mod shop to do the tune and dyno.
I make it clear to them I want the CEL to go away. They do the work, CEL gone, and I get one of those cool dyno charts, 408HP, 410T.
Sure enough about the fifth time I start the car, CEL is on
So im going back today, any advice would help. They mainly do mustangs, but did one of the forums members vette without a problem.
It's more than likely your rear O2's. The LG's move the cats away from their stock location so the computer thinks they are not there or working properly.....The tolerances are out of whack. Tell the tuner you want the rear O2's shut off. This will take care of the problem.
